1. Classic Mickey and Minnie Mouse Hearts

Mickey and Minnie Mouse bring timeless Disney charm to your Valentine's Day manicure with their iconic silhouettes and romantic connection. Paint classic Mickey ears on some nails and add Minnie's signature bow on others, incorporating red hearts and polka dots for Valentine's flair. This design works beautifully on a white or red base, with black silhouettes creating that instantly recognizable Disney aesthetic everyone loves.

Mickey and Minnie Mouse Valentine's Day nail art with hearts and bows on white base

The simplicity of silhouettes makes this design surprisingly easy, even for beginners, requiring only steady hands and basic nail art tools. Use a dotting tool for perfect circular ears and a thin brush for bow details. Add small red hearts floating around the characters for extra Valentine's romance. This nostalgic design appeals to Disney fans of all ages and creates conversation-starting nails perfect for Valentine's celebrations.

2. Snoopy and Woodstock Love

Snoopy and his little bird friend Woodstock create an adorable Valentine's nail design filled with nostalgic Peanuts charm. These beloved characters translate beautifully to nail art with their simple shapes and recognizable features. Paint Snoopy lying on his doghouse, dreaming of love, or create sweet scenes of Snoopy and Woodstock sharing hearts. The classic comic strip aesthetic works perfectly on white or light pink bases.

Snoopy and Woodstock cartoon valentine nails with hearts and comic strip style

Use black liner for character outlines and fill with white for Snoopy and yellow for Woodstock, keeping the cartoon style simple and clean. Add small red hearts, "LOVE" text bubbles, or even tiny panels mimicking comic strip frames for authentic Peanuts vibes. This design is perfect for anyone who grew up loving Charlie Brown and friends, bringing childhood memories to your Valentine's Day celebration.

3. Hello Kitty Valentine's

Hello Kitty's sweet, innocent charm makes her perfect for Valentine's Day nail designs that are cute, kawaii, and undeniably feminine. Her simple face—just dots for eyes, whiskers, and her signature bow—is surprisingly easy to recreate on nails, even for beginners. Paint her iconic face on accent nails with a white base, adding red or pink bows for Valentine's flair. Surround with hearts, flowers, or polka dots on the remaining nails.

Hello Kitty Valentine's Day nails with pink bow and hearts kawaii style

The minimalist design of Hello Kitty means you don't need advanced artistic skills to create recognizable, adorable results. Use a dotting tool for her eyes and nose, a thin brush for whiskers, and create her bow with simple brush strokes. Alternate between Hello Kitty faces and solid pink or red nails with small heart accents for a balanced, cohesive look that's playful without being overwhelming.

8. Classic Comic Book POW! Hearts

Comic book-style nails combine vintage pop art with Valentine's themes for bold, graphic designs that make a statement. Use classic comic elements like "POW!" "BOOM!" and "ZAP!" text bubbles, but fill them with hearts or make the words themselves Valentine's-themed like "LOVE!" Replace traditional explosion effects with bursting hearts. The bold outlines, Ben-Day dots, and bright primary colors create that authentic comic book aesthetic everyone recognizes and loves.

Retro comic book style Valentine's nails with POW text bubbles and hearts

Paint backgrounds in bright primary colors—red, yellow, blue—then add black-outlined text bubbles with bold lettering in contrasting colors. Use a thin brush or nail art pen for clean, thick outlines characteristic of comic art. Add Ben-Day dot patterns using a dotting tool for authentic vintage comic texture. Include small hearts, stars, and action lines for dynamic movement. This retro design appeals to comic fans and anyone wanting unique, conversation-starting Valentine's nails.

15. Cartoon Bees and Honey

Cartoon bees create punny, adorable Valentine's nails perfect for the "Bee Mine" message beloved on Valentine's cards. Draw cute, chubby bees with big eyes, tiny wings, and happy smiles, surrounded by hearts, honeycombs, and flowers. The yellow and black color scheme provides a striking contrast while maintaining Valentine's sweetness. These industrious little characters symbolize working hard for love while delivering adorable, pun-based Valentine's Day charm that makes people smile.

Vintage Strawberry Shortcake Valentine's nails with berry theme and hearts

Paint simplified bees with round yellow bodies, black stripes, and translucent white wings outlined in black. Give them cartoon faces with large eyes and cheerful expressions. Add hexagonal honeycomb patterns on some nails, tiny flowers, and hearts throughout. Include "Bee Mine" text or just rely on the visual pun everyone will recognize. Use yellow, black, white, and touches of pink or red for hearts. This whimsical design combines nature, cuteness, and Valentine's wordplay perfectly.
